Freescale i.MX audio complex with WM8960 codec
Required properties:
- compatible : "fsl,imx-audio-wm8960", "fsl,imx7d-evk-wm8960"
- model : The user-visible name of this sound complex
- cpu-dai : The phandle of CPU DAI
- audio-codec : The phandle of the WM8960 audio codec
- audio-routing : A list of the connections between audio components.
Each entry is a pair of strings, the first being the
connection's sink, the second being the connection's
source. Valid names could be power supplies, WM8960
pins, and the jacks on the board:
Power supplies:
* Mic Bias
Board connectors:
* Mic Jack
* Headphone Jack
* Ext Spk
Optional properties:
- hp-det-gpios : The gpio pin to detect plug in/out event that happens to
Headphone jack.
- mic-det-gpios: The gpio pin to detect plug in/out event that happens to
Microphone jack.
Example:
sound: sound {
compatible = "fsl,imx7d-evk-wm8960",
"fsl,imx-audio-wm8960";
model = "wm8960-audio";
cpu-dai = <&sai1>;
audio-codec = <&wm8960>;
codec-master;
/*
* hp-det = <hp-det-pin hp-det-polarity>;
* hp-det-pin: JD1 JD2 or JD3
* hp-det-polarity = 0: hp detect high for headphone
* hp-det-polarity = 1: hp detect high for speaker
*/
hp-det = <2 0>;
hp-det-gpios = <&gpio1 0 0>;
mic-det-gpios = <&gpio1 0 0>;
audio-routing =
"Headphone Jack", "HP_L",
"Headphone Jack", "HP_R",
"Ext Spk", "SPK_LP",
"Ext Spk", "SPK_LN",
"Ext Spk", "SPK_RP",
"Ext Spk", "SPK_RN",
"LINPUT2", "Mic Jack",
"LINPUT3", "Mic Jack",
"RINPUT1", "Main MIC",
"RINPUT2", "Main MIC",
"Mic Jack", "MICB",
"Main MIC", "MICB",
"CPU-Playback", "ASRC-Playback",
"Playback", "CPU-Playback",
"ASRC-Capture", "CPU-Capture",
"CPU-Capture", "Capture";
};
